New social network launching

Fanbookz, a new social community for football fans, has teamed up with Burton Albion and wants Brewers fans to get involved from this weekend.

The Fanbookz team have been chatting with Gary Rowett, Ben Robinson, Mike Whitlow, Rory Delap, Darren Moore – even Tom Sloan on the Burton Mail – to discover what Burton fans think of their team’s promotion chances and what they want from their social media.

You can register up until midnight on Wednesday April 16 to come on board this virtual home for supporters, designed so that you can share photographs, videos, comments and access the latest news, stats, games and prizes.

Burton Albion were approached as a fine example of a community club to be part of the
action over this Easter period. Fanbookz will select the most suitable responders and ask them to take an early look at the site from April18-29 and then to complete a brief user survey.
